From time to time customers are taken a back by the estimated cost of necessary repairs for their vehicle.
A few weeks ago a customer brought in his twelve year old Nissan Maxima with a brake vibration problem. The car had about a hundred and fifty-five thousand miles on the odometer. Our ASE Certified Technician turned in a repair estimation for a complete brake job, including brake fluid flush, at over seven-hundred dollars.
“What!?” The customer exclaimed. “I’m not sure that car isn’t worth what you are quoting me for the brake job!” He thought about it for a few minutes and then asked. “Do you know where I can get a good used car?”
“You have a good used car.” I reminded him. “You know this vehicle well. You likely have all of the maintenance records on it. It would easily cost you six, seven-thousand dollars or more to replace this with a ‘good used car’ and then you don’t know what you are getting.”
The customer thought this over for a couple of minutes and then told us to go ahead and fix the car.
This customer came back a few weeks later with a friend of his who was having a problem with his Jeep where he wasn’t getting much heat. While the customer was advising his friend to bring the jeep to us for evaluation he was also remarking at how well his Nissan was stopping and handling since the brake job.
This customer not only came back but brought in a new customer in with him.
